- The distance between Perpignan, France and Hanmer Forest, New Zealand is approximately 19,195 km or 11,928 mi.
- To reach Perpignan in this distance one would set out from Hanmer Forest bearing 275.1°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Perpignan bearing 271.7° or W .
- Perpignan has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Hanmer Forest has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Perpignan is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Hanmer Forest is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average temperature is 5.3 °C (9.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.1 °C (7.4°F) more in Perpignan.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 579.1 mm (22.8 in) less which is equivalent to 579.1 l/m² (14.21 US gal/ft²) or 5,791,000 l/ha (619,096 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.5° higher in Perpignan than in Hanmer Forest.
